Keeping You Informed – Storm Debris Removal in Beau Chene

Beau Chene’s storm debris removal is now covered under St. Tammany Parish’s debris removal contract.  We are awaiting news from the parish regarding a timeline to commence the debris removal in Beau Chene.  We believe it will start within a few weeks, if not sooner.  The parish’s goal is to have debris pickup completed by the end of October.

Debris pickup will include vegetative (green) debris, white debris (appliances), and construction and demolition debris (sheetrock, baseboards, etc…).  The different types of debris MUST BE SEPERATED in piles and placed near the curb and/or on the home side of the drainage ditches.  FEMA contractor will not pickup electronics, hazardous waste or household garbage in Beau Chene.

  • Do not place debris in the road, drainage systems, on top of water meters or against trees, mailboxes, fences, fire hydrants, utility poles or gas meters. The contractors are using very large pieces of equipment to pick up these piles. Placing debris piles by these structures make removal difficult and dangerous.

  • Place debris in large piles.

  • Combining multiple small piles from neighbors together to make larger ones is more efficient.

  • Vegetative (green) debris MUST NOT include plastic bags

Here is a link to the St. Tammany Parish website debris removal page: http://www.stpgov.org/debris This page provides answers to frequently asked questions.  Also, see the below FEMA guide to identify the different types of debris that must be separated.

Keeping You Informed – Hurricane Prep

Tropical Storm Ida

The BCHOA is watching the news carefully and monitoring the forecasts for Tropical Storm Ida. The storm is predicated to start impacting our area over the weekend. There is the potential for winds higher than 40 mph and rainfall of up to 15 inches.

In anticipation of possible tropical-storm-force winds, we are closing the right-hand member lanes at the MAIN and EAST gates and disabling the barrier gate security arms. This measure is to prevent wind damage of the automated gate arms. The right-hand member lanes will be closed today, Friday, August 27th, at 2:00 pm and remain closed through Monday, August 30th.

BCHOA Public Works (PW) Staff have implemented storm protocols including:
• Inspection of all community drainage ditches and culverts and debris removal if needed
• All equipment is fueled and tested including generators, chain saws, pumps, trackhoe, backhoe, dump truck and trailers
• Adequate diesel and gasoline fuel is stored to operate equipment & generators through the storm’s potential impact
• BCHOA Storm Protocols for water and sewerage locations are implemented
